Optimization of the cycle time of robotics resistance spot welding for automotive applications

In the automobile manufacturing industry, resistance spot welding (RSW) is widely used, especially to build car's body. The RSW a standard and wide-ranging joining technique in several assembling ventures, showing wide range of possibilities for competent procedure. Robots are commonly used various industrial applications. After completing design, interest increases improve designed processes, cost-reduction, environmental impact, increase time productivity when all said be done. this paper, robot movement between two points, path followed while spotting, gripping payload-carrying activities, numbers holds, moves, possibility enhance interaction four were analyzed using an offline Robot simulation software “DELMIA-V5.” body shop assembly line SML ISUZU plant has robots that perform about 209 spots 532 s. optimal model reduced whole cycle by 68 s, after modification proper sequencing, a12.7% reduction was achieved. “DELMIA-V5” good potential produce algorithms saving precious time. It enables organization promote higher quality encourage meaningful creativity reducing design flaws.
